MI vs GT, IPL 2025: Gujarat Titans captain Shubman Gill was full of energy on the field during their IPL 2025 match against Mumbai Indians at the Wankhede Stadium.
Shubman Gill had a great first innings as a leader. His decisions worked perfectly, helping GT dominate with the ball and keep MI to a low score.
Shubman Gill impressed one and all with his smart bowling changes and sharp field placements. Gill also contributed personally by taking three catches, adding to the pressure on the Mumbai Indians.
What grabbed everyone’s attention was Shubman Gill’s fiery reaction after catching Tilak Varma. The Mumbai Indians batter was dismissed in the 14th over when Gerald Coetzee took his first wicket of the match.
Coetzee bowled a full delivery wide outside off, tempting Tilak to drive. But the left-hander mistimed it, sending a simple catch to mid-off where Shubman Gill was ready.
After taking the catch, Gill celebrated with a bold gesture by putting a finger to his lips to silence the Wankhede crowd. The moment quickly went viral online.

Tilak Varma struggled with the bat, scoring just 7 off 7 balls without a boundary. His dismissal left the Mumbai Indians at 113/6.
MI had a rough start, losing both openers early. Will Jacks (53) and Suryakumar Yadav (35) steadied things, but a collapse followed.
Corbin Bosch added a crucial 27 off 22 balls to help MI reach 155. For GT, Sai Kishore was the best bowler with 2/34, while the rest of the bowlers took one wicket each.
